Review : Roadside Romeo


Jugal Hansraj has just presented a wonderful package to us. This 3d animated movie has everything to gain the attraction. We have voice of Saif Ali Khan for Romeo the Dog and we have Karina Kapoor also associated. First Indian animated movie which is advertised like a normal bollywood flick ie proper effort to advertising too.

Jugal Hansraj's directorial debut is an animation. Where in India most of the animated movies never made a good business he took the risk to start an animation. But its not a disappointment but a pleasure to watch such an animation movie which looks full of effort and time.

First thing I want to talk about the movie is its animation, its world class and first time I found myself enjoying a bollywood animation flick with heart. The animation is top notch, the detailing of characters is perfect. For many you may not notice but hard work is clearly visible. I guess they have used motion capture technique for the animation. The movements, expression of animated characters are again more than satisfying.

The best thing was to Was to Watch such a wonderful animation made only for Indian context. Full points to Jugal and his animation team, though involvement of Walt-Disney is responsible for this product but ultimately its an Indian production for India specially.

Now move to a little bit of story, the Romeo is a dog who was rich once but now abandoned on the street of Mumbai as the family to whom he belonged has moved to another place and left him on his own. He meets a gang of roadside dogs, he befriended with them with a business of hair saloon, kind of entertaining characters with cat among them who wants to do like a dog. We have another don type dog-Charlie Anna (voiceover of Javed Jaffery) with south Indian accent. He also got 3 of his bitches who he calls Charlie's Angels. ..

Things going fine but one day he (Romeo) follows a song and found that the singer is Laila (a bitch) voice by Kareena Kapoor) and he instantly fell in love with her. While he tries to convince her, Charlie Anna, who also happened to have crush over her too now want to get rid of Romeo. There is another important factor to note is the municipal van who catches stray dogs, every once a while it appears and all dogs seems to be united to dodge it. So that goes with story with a happy ending like any other bollywood flick.

While you know the movie is animation but it is not really targeted to children only, its movie which everyone should enjoy. Ofcourse, don't expect it near reality, its fun to watch. And its better than nonsense bollywood flicks where story becomes irrational just to wind up things.

This movie enjoys many famous bollywood movie flicks, you may notice DDLJ and will see Dhoom poster around in the movie. Javed Jaffery is nice as always and he is always able to do the miracle with his voice. Other characters were nicely sketched. You will remember every character even after the movie is over.

In the end, all I can say that you will enjoy this animation flick. Remember that its an animation but never means targeted to kids only. Its for everyone and those who thinks that animation is for kids only then should watch it and have an experience of good entertainment.
